									<p data-start="1009" data-end="1303">When it comes to improving your website’s visibility, one of the most effective and often overlooked strategies is simply <strong data-start="1135" data-end="1173">writing helpful, valuable articles</strong>. Many people think SEO is all about keywords, technical tweaks, or expensive tools. But the truth is much simpler:</p><p data-start="1305" data-end="1395"><strong data-start="1308" data-end="1395"><b><img decoding="async" class="emoji" role="img" draggable="false" src="https://s.w.org/images/core/emoji/17.0.2/svg/1f536.svg" alt="&#x1f536;" /> </b>Publishing useful content is one of the biggest if not the most important, ranking signals Google cares about.</strong></p><p data-start="1397" data-end="1598">In this article, I’ll break down the <strong data-start="1435" data-end="1477">importance of writing articles for SEO</strong>, why helpfulness beats keyword stuffing, and how every small business can build organic traffic through quality content.</p>								</div>
				</div>
					</div>
				</div>
		<div class="elementor-element elementor-element-e639259 e-flex e-con-boxed e-con e-parent" data-id="e639259" data-element_type="container">
					<div class="e-con-inner">
				<div class="elementor-element elementor-element-398651f elementor-widget elementor-widget-text-editor" data-id="398651f" data-element_type="widget" data-widget_type="text-editor.default">
				<div class="elementor-widget-container">
									<h2 data-start="1605" data-end="1645">Why Writing Articles Helps Your SEO</h2><p data-start="1647" data-end="1750">Search engines like Google, work with one goal in mind:</p><p data-start="1647" data-end="1750"><strong data-start="1692" data-end="1750">&#8220;Give users the best possible answer to their question.&#8221;</strong></p><p data-start="1752" data-end="1812">When you publish articles that genuinely help your audience:</p><ul data-start="1813" data-end="2058"><li data-start="1813" data-end="1850"><p data-start="1815" data-end="1850">Google understands your expertise</p></li><li data-start="1851" data-end="1897"><p data-start="1853" data-end="1897">You cover more relevant keywords naturally</p></li><li data-start="1898" data-end="1930"><p data-start="1900" data-end="1930">Your website gains authority</p></li><li data-start="1931" data-end="1962"><p data-start="1933" data-end="1962">Other sites may link to you, generating backlinks</p></li><li data-start="1963" data-end="2009"><p data-start="1965" data-end="2009">Users spend more time reading your content</p></li><li data-start="2010" data-end="2058"><p data-start="2012" data-end="2058">You earn trust, which increases conversions</p></li></ul><p data-start="2060" data-end="2125">This combination creates powerful SEO signals for Search engines that impact the Domain Authority of your website.</p><p data-start="2127" data-end="2147">Let’s break it down.</p>								</div>

									<h3 data-start="2154" data-end="2212">1. Articles Let You Target More Keywords Naturally</h3><p data-path-to-node="3">Think of your website like a physical brick-and-mortar store.</p><p data-path-to-node="4"><b data-path-to-node="4" data-index-in-node="0">Your Homepage is the Main Entrance.</b> It has space for one big sign above the door, usually your business name and your main category (e.g., <i data-path-to-node="4" data-index-in-node="138">&#8220;Joe&#8217;s Plumbing: Emergency Repairs&#8221;</i>). You can’t list every single bolt, pipe, and service you offer on that one sign. If you tried, it would look cluttered, and nobody would read it. Google works the same way; if you try to stuff 50 different keywords onto your homepage, you end up ranking for none of them.</p><p data-path-to-node="5"><b data-path-to-node="5" data-index-in-node="0">Your Service Pages are the Aisle Markers.</b> These pages target specific services (e.g., <i data-path-to-node="5" data-index-in-node="86">&#8220;Water Heater Repair&#8221;</i> or <i data-path-to-node="5" data-index-in-node="111">&#8220;Drain Cleaning&#8221;</i>). They are great for people who already know exactly what they need. But again, you only have a limited number of services.</p><p data-path-to-node="6"><b data-path-to-node="6" data-index-in-node="0">Your Articles are the Side Doors.</b> This is where the magic happens. While your homepage waits for people to search for &#8220;Plumber,&#8221; your blog posts go out and find the people who are searching for <i data-path-to-node="6" data-index-in-node="194">problems</i>.</p><ul data-path-to-node="7"><li><p data-path-to-node="7,0,0"><b data-path-to-node="7,0,0" data-index-in-node="0">The Problem:</b> A homeowner doesn&#8217;t know they need a &#8220;hydro-jetting service&#8221; (your product).</p></li><li><p data-path-to-node="7,1,0"><b data-path-to-node="7,1,0" data-index-in-node="0">The Search:</b> They type <i data-path-to-node="7,1,0" data-index-in-node="22">&#8220;Why is my kitchen sink draining slowly?&#8221;</i> into Google.</p></li><li><p data-path-to-node="7,2,0"><b data-path-to-node="7,2,0" data-index-in-node="0">The Solution:</b> You write an article titled <i data-path-to-node="7,2,0" data-index-in-node="42">&#8220;5 Reasons Your Sink is Draining Slowly (and How to Fix It).&#8221;</i></p></li></ul><p data-path-to-node="8">By writing that article, you have created a <b data-path-to-node="8" data-index-in-node="44">new doorway</b> into your business. That visitor lands on your site to read the advice, realises the DIY fix is too hard, and sees your &#8220;Book an Appointment&#8221; button.</p><h5 data-path-to-node="9">Why This Matters for Growth</h5><p data-path-to-node="10">If you don&#8217;t write articles, you are limiting yourself to the small group of people who are ready to buy <i data-path-to-node="10" data-index-in-node="105">right now</i>.</p><p data-path-to-node="11">By writing articles, you can target hundreds of different &#8220;Long-Tail Keywords&#8221;, specific questions, phrases, and problems your customers have.</p><ul data-path-to-node="12"><li><p data-path-to-node="12,0,0"><b data-path-to-node="12,0,0" data-index-in-node="0">Without a blog:</b> You have ~5 pages indexed by Google. That is 5 chances to be found.</p></li><li><p data-path-to-node="12,1,0"><b data-path-to-node="12,1,0" data-index-in-node="0">With a blog:</b> You can have 50, 100, or 500 pages indexed. That is <b data-path-to-node="12,1,0" data-index-in-node="65">500 separate doorways</b> inviting potential customers into your world.</p></li></ul><p data-path-to-node="13">Every article you write is a permanent asset that works 24/7 to catch traffic that your homepage would never see.</p>								</div>

									<h3 data-start="2581" data-end="2638">2. Useful Articles: Build Trust With Your Audience</h3><p data-start="2639" data-end="2711">Google doesn’t just want long articles.<br data-start="2678" data-end="2681" />It wants <strong data-start="2690" data-end="2710">helpful articles</strong>.</p><p data-start="2713" data-end="2767">When you answer real questions your audience has, you:</p><ul data-start="2768" data-end="2843"><li data-start="2768" data-end="2787"><p data-start="2770" data-end="2787">Build authority</p></li><li data-start="2788" data-end="2806"><p data-start="2790" data-end="2806">Show expertise</p></li><li data-start="2807" data-end="2843"><p data-start="2809" data-end="2843">Keep readers on your site longer</p></li></ul><p data-start="2845" data-end="2916">This sends strong signals to Google that your content deserves to rank.</p><p data-start="2918" data-end="3079">If you run a local business and publish an article that helps people solve a specific problem, Google sees your site as more trustworthy and relevant. For years, SEO &#8220;gurus&#8221; told business owners they needed to write 2,000-word essays to rank on Google. That is no longer true.</p><p data-path-to-node="4">Google has gotten smarter. It doesn&#8217;t just measure <span style="box-sizing: border-box; margin: 0px; padding: 0px;">the <strong>length of</strong> your article; it also measures its <strong>helpfulness</strong></span>.</p><p data-path-to-node="5">If a user asks, <i data-path-to-node="5" data-index-in-node="16">&#8220;How do I reset my furnace?&#8221;</i> and you write a 3,000-word history of heating systems, the user will leave. But if you give them a clear, 300-word step-by-step guide that actually fixes the problem, they will stay, read, and trust you.</p><p data-path-to-node="6"><b data-path-to-node="6" data-index-in-node="0">When you genuinely answer your customers&#8217; questions, three powerful things happen:</b></p><h5 data-path-to-node="7">2.1. You Prove You Are the Expert (E-E-A-T)</h5><p data-path-to-node="8">Google uses a metric called <b data-path-to-node="8" data-index-in-node="28">E-E-A-T</b> (Experience, Expertise, Authoritativeness, and Trustworthiness). They want to send users to people who actually know what they are talking about.</p><ul data-path-to-node="9"><li><p data-path-to-node="9,0,0">Anyone can use AI to generate a generic article.</p></li><li><p data-path-to-node="9,1,0">But only <i data-path-to-node="9,1,0" data-index-in-node="9">you</i> can write about the specific nuances of your local area or your specific industry.</p></li><li><p data-path-to-node="9,2,0"><b data-path-to-node="9,2,0" data-index-in-node="0">The Result:</b> When you share specific, helpful advice, Google tags your site as an &#8220;Authority,&#8221; making it easier for <i data-path-to-node="9,2,0" data-index-in-node="115">all</i> your pages to rank higher.</p></li></ul><h5 data-path-to-node="10">2.2. You Stop the &#8220;Pogo-Sticking&#8221;</h5><p data-path-to-node="11">&#8220;Pogo-sticking&#8221; is when a user clicks your link, realises it’s useless fluff, and immediately clicks the &#8220;Back&#8221; button to try the next result. Google hates this. It tells them your site is low quality.</p><ul data-path-to-node="12"><li><p data-path-to-node="12,0,0"><b data-path-to-node="12,0,0" data-index-in-node="0">The Fix:</b> When your article solves a problem, the user stays to read it. They might even click to another page to learn more.</p></li><li><p data-path-to-node="12,1,0"><b data-path-to-node="12,1,0" data-index-in-node="0">The Signal:</b> This increased &#8220;Time on Page&#8221; screams to Google: <i data-path-to-node="12,1,0" data-index-in-node="61">&#8220;This result is perfect! Keep ranking it #1.&#8221;</i></p></li></ul><h5 data-path-to-node="13">2.3. You Build Trust Before You Even Meet</h5><p data-path-to-node="14">People buy from businesses they trust. An article is often the first handshake.</p><ul data-path-to-node="15"><li><p data-path-to-node="15,0,0">If you give them free value upfront (by solving a small problem), they are far more likely to pay you for the big solution later.</p></li></ul><h5 data-path-to-node="17">Real-World Example: The &#8220;Helpful&#8221; Mechanic</h5><p data-path-to-node="18">Imagine you run a local auto repair shop.</p><ul data-path-to-node="19"><li><p data-path-to-node="19,0,0"><b data-path-to-node="19,0,0" data-index-in-node="0">The &#8220;Old SEO&#8221; Way:</b> You write a generic page called &#8220;Car Repair Services&#8221; with a list of prices.</p></li><li><p data-path-to-node="19,1,0"><b data-path-to-node="19,1,0" data-index-in-node="0">The &#8220;Helpful&#8221; Way:</b> You write a specific article titled: <i data-path-to-node="19,1,0" data-index-in-node="56">&#8220;Why is my AC blowing hot air? (3 Simple Checks Before You Call a Mechanic).&#8221;</i></p></li></ul><p data-path-to-node="20">The outcome would be that a local driver googles their problem, they find your article, and they realise the issue is low refrigerant.</p><p data-path-to-node="21,2,0">They will probably think, <i data-path-to-node="21,2,0" data-index-in-node="12">&#8220;Wow, these guys are honest. They gave me the answer instead of just trying to take my money.&#8221;</i></p><p data-path-to-node="21,3,0">Who do you think they will call to refill that refrigerant? <b data-path-to-node="21,3,0" data-index-in-node="70">You.</b></p><p data-path-to-node="22"><b data-path-to-node="22" data-index-in-node="0">Bottom Line:</b> Don&#8217;t write to fill a word count. Write to help a human. If the human is happy, Google is happy.</p>								</div>

									<h3 data-start="3086" data-end="3137">3. Quality Content Helps You Earn Backlinks</h3><p data-path-to-node="3">First, let’s define the term: A <b data-path-to-node="3" data-index-in-node="32">backlink</b> is simply when another website includes a link on its page that points to <i data-path-to-node="3" data-index-in-node="117">your</i> website.</p><p data-path-to-node="4">Think of a backlink as a &#8220;vote of confidence&#8221;. If a local news site, a popular blogger, or an industry partner links to your site, they are effectively telling Google: <i data-path-to-node="4" data-index-in-node="168">&#8220;I trust this business. Their information is good.&#8221;</i> The more of these high-quality &#8220;votes&#8221; you have, the higher Google will rank you.</p><p data-path-to-node="5"><b data-path-to-node="5" data-index-in-node="0">But here is the catch:</b> Nobody links to a boring &#8220;Contact Us&#8221; page or a generic service menu. There is no reason to share those.</p><p data-path-to-node="6">People only link to content that provides <b data-path-to-node="6" data-index-in-node="42">value</b>.</p><ul data-path-to-node="7"><li><p data-path-to-node="7,0,0"><b data-path-to-node="7,0,0" data-index-in-node="0">Useful:</b> A checklist or a &#8220;How-To&#8221; guide.</p></li><li><p data-path-to-node="7,1,0"><b data-path-to-node="7,1,0" data-index-in-node="0">Unique:</b> Data or a case study that only you have.</p></li><li><p data-path-to-node="7,2,0"><b data-path-to-node="7,2,0" data-index-in-node="0">Insightful:</b> An expert opinion on a new industry trend.</p></li></ul><p data-path-to-node="8"><b data-path-to-node="8" data-index-in-node="0">The &#8220;Linkable Asset&#8221; Strategy.</b> When you write a high-quality article, for example, <i data-path-to-node="8" data-index-in-node="81">&#8220;The Complete Guide to Winterising Your Home in [Your City]&#8221;, </i>you create a resource.</p><ul data-path-to-node="9"><li><p data-path-to-node="9,0,0">A local real estate agent might link to it in their newsletter for new homeowners.</p></li><li><p data-path-to-node="9,1,0">A community Facebook group might share it.</p></li><li><p data-path-to-node="9,2,0">A local news blog might reference it.</p></li></ul><p data-path-to-node="10">Without that article, those links would never have happened. You can’t force backlinks; you have to <i data-path-to-node="10" data-index-in-node="93">earn</i> them. And the only way to earn them is to give the internet something worth talking about.</p>								</div>

									<h3 data-start="3562" data-end="3623">4. Articles Increase Your Website’s Topical Authority</h3><p data-start="3624" data-end="3753">When you publish multiple articles around a topic your business covers, Google begins to view your website as a <strong data-start="3736" data-end="3752">topic expert</strong>.</p><p data-start="3755" data-end="3792"><strong>Example:</strong><br data-start="3763" data-end="3766" />If your website publishes:</p><ul data-start="3793" data-end="3912"><li data-start="3793" data-end="3823"><p data-start="3795" data-end="3823">“How to improve local SEO”</p></li><li data-start="3824" data-end="3874"><p data-start="3826" data-end="3874">“How to optimize your Google Business Profile”</p></li><li data-start="3875" data-end="3912"><p data-start="3877" data-end="3912">“How reviews affect local rankings”</p></li></ul><p data-start="3914" data-end="4044">Google connects the dots.<br data-start="3939" data-end="3942" />It learns that you understand this area deeply, and rewards your entire website with better rankings.</p>								</div>

									<h3 data-start="4051" data-end="4114">5. Articles Guide Visitors Through Their Buying Journey</h3><p data-start="4115" data-end="4150">Not everyone is ready to buy today.</p><p data-start="4152" data-end="4183">Articles help you connect with:</p><ul data-start="4184" data-end="4304"><li data-start="4184" data-end="4228"><p data-start="4186" data-end="4228">People who are just starting to research</p></li><li data-start="4229" data-end="4257"><p data-start="4231" data-end="4257">People comparing options</p></li><li data-start="4258" data-end="4304"><p data-start="4260" data-end="4304">People looking for tips before they decide</p></li></ul><p data-start="4306" data-end="4432">Helpful content keeps you top of mind, builds trust, and increases the chance they’ll choose your business when they’re ready.</p><p data-start="4434" data-end="4537">This is where the <strong data-start="4452" data-end="4494">importance of writing articles for SEO</strong> and <strong data-start="4499" data-end="4518">business growth</strong> overlaps perfectly.</p>								</div>

									<h2 data-start="4544" data-end="4588">6. Articles Improve Internal Linking</h2><p data-start="4589" data-end="4609">Internal links help:</p><ul data-start="4610" data-end="4725"><li data-start="4610" data-end="4650"><p data-start="4612" data-end="4650">Search engines understand your pages</p></li><li data-start="4651" data-end="4685"><p data-start="4653" data-end="4685">Visitors navigate your content</p></li><li data-start="4686" data-end="4725"><p data-start="4688" data-end="4725">Authority flows throughout your site</p></li></ul><p data-start="4727" data-end="4846">Every new article you publish becomes another opportunity to connect related content and strengthen your SEO structure.</p>								</div>
